Default MotoGP 2011 - Here we go again!

Well it's here again. The wait to see the top racing class is finally over this weekend with MotoGP's arrival in Qatar.

At the start of another season I am trying hard to curb my enthusiasm for what will probably be another mainly dull season in the big class but there's still the nagging childlike hope that this season will show some of the best racing I've ever seen. But probably not. Maybe next season with the new 1000CC and streetbike engine rules.

The difference this season is that we have key players moving teams with Vale going to Ducati and Stoner going to Honda and this might just shake things up enough to make it an interesting season. Looking at the results in testing Rossi is going to struggle while Stoner is on it straight away. Thumbelina Pedrobot will be a major player if he can aviod getting thrown off the bike at inopertune moments. Then you have crazy Jorge. He won't want to give up his number 1 plate without a scrap and I think there should be a few scraps through the year. You boys in the states have Ben Spies stepping up to the factory team and given that he wasn't far off last season his results will be interesting to watch, as will Nickys. Will he benefit from another year on the Duc and any improvements to the machine driven by Rossi and Burgess. I hope so as Nicky seems like a good guy. Only met him once and he was as nice as everyone says. Us brits have Cal Crutchlow to cheer for so hopefully he'll be more successful than James Toseland was.

Moto 2 provided some of the best racing last year and hopefully that will carry on through to the 2011 season.

Is anyone still interested in MotoGP? What are your predictions for the season?

It's going to be a really interesting season. Stoner looks ridiculously fast on that Honda, Spies seems a bit faster than Lorenzo so far and that could end up being the best battle of the season.

I really want to see how Rossi develops the Ducati over the season as well. It has a monster engine and sophisticated electronics, but as proven, to make it a winner, it has to be ridden in a specific way (i.e by Stoner) I think Rossi can develop it into a more rideable package and then Hayden can benefit as well.

I still think WSBK is the best racing on earth, but Moto2 is epic as well.
